High-purity amine-reactive rhodamine dye for red fluorescence labeling
This amine-reactive red fluorescent dye is a mixed isomer NHS ester of carboxytetramethylrhodamine (TAMRA). It is widely used for covalent labeling of proteins and alkylamino-modified nucleic acids. TAMRA conjugates exhibit a fluorescence quantum yield approximately one-fourth that of fluorescein, yet often appear brighter due to strong excitation by the 546 nm mercury-arc lamp line and enhanced photostability. TAMRA is also efficiently excited by the 543 nm green He-Ne laser, making it well-suited for microscopy and flow cytometry.

Properties
-
CAS Number: 246256-50-8
-
Molecular Weight: 527.5
-
Empirical Formula: C₂₉H₂₅N₃O₇
-
Absorption [nm]: 554 ± 3
-
Emission [nm]: 577 ± 3
-
ε [M⁻¹ cm⁻¹]: > 80,000
-
Buffer System for Fluorescence Readings: T&S Buffer, pH 9
-
Solubility: Acetonitrile, DMF, DMSO
-
Appearance (color): Violet
-
Appearance (form): Solid powder
-
Storage: –20 °C. Keep dry. Protect from light, especially in solution.
-
Trade Name: 5/6-Carboxytetramethylrhodamine, succinimidyl ester, mixed isomers; 5/6-TAMRA-SE
-
Reactive Moiety: NHS ester, reacts with 1° amines to form a stable amide linkage
Application
Flow cytometry (FACS), bioconjugation of proteins and nucleic acids.
